Output d4063bd53fd231376570981b144507151d3ea35b7ec33209aa09e76949986df7:0

value
20480433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c55823a61b841b827c8101f3969c8c82a26c641 OP_EQUAL
address
MGKNqKwoMHqj58erb9JDzHiG6JRVnEiU4c
transaction
d4063bd53fd231376570981b144507151d3ea35b7ec33209aa09e76949986df7
spent
true